Term 2 Learning Goals

Learning Goals 2.1

Reading/Language Arts:

*Identify and create compound words

*Identify and use homonyms

*Answer literal and simply inferential who, what, when, where, why, how and what if questions

*Identify main idea and some details in narrative text or topic and some details in informational text

*Identify simple facts and opinions

*Arrange in sequential order a listing of events found in narrative/informational texts

*Use Standard English grammar:  Verbs (helping verbs, irregular verbs)

*Use Standard English grammar:  Verb Tense (conjugation and purpose for past, present, future)

*Use Standard English grammar:  Pronouns (subject, singular, plural)

 

Learning Goals 2.2

Reading/Language Arts:

*Blend & segment spoken words into syllables and syllables into phonemes.

*Use inflectional ending (-s, -es, -ed, -ing) to produce or analyze new words

*Identify and create contractions

*Answer literal and simply inferential questions about main characters, setting, events, characters’ actions, motives, traits, emotions

*Identify simple cause and effects

*Draw conclusions based on information from narrative/informational text

*Recognize or generate an appropriate summary or paraphrasing of events or ideas in text

*Retell a story orally and in writing including characters, setting, problem, events, resolution

*Writing Process (drafting, revising, editing, publishing

*Compose descriptive text

*Possessive Nouns

*Adjectives (possessive, comparative, superlative)

*Prepositions

*Apostrophes (contractions, possessives)

 

Learning Goals 2.1

Math:

*Read and write time to the hour, half-hour, quarter-hour, and five-minute intervals using digital and analog clocks

*Tally, record, interpret, and predict outcomes based on given information

 

Learning Goals 2.2

Math:

*Money             

 *Polygons (rhombus, square, triangle, trapezoid, rectangle, pentagon, hexagon, octagon, decagon)

*Odd/Even          

*Perimeter, Area

*Place Value         

*Measurement—Length (inch, foot, yard, centimeter, meter)
